If your business is concerned with developing fantastic outdoor environments, then you’ll want to take landscaping seriously. Fortunately, the practice of landscaping has evolved considerably in recent times, and there’s a solution to fit just about every project. Let’s take a look at a few of the best of them.

Advanced Lawn and Turf Management Techniques

Modern lawns are more durable and good-looking than ever before, thanks to a range of techniques and technologies. In some cases, artificial grass can be interspersed with the real thing, as is often the case in high-end cricket and football pitches. Or, real or artificial grass could be used exclusively.

Of course, there are also chemical agents that can help grass to be more easily managed, and automated mowers that might help to reduce the cost of maintaining it, too.

 

Efficient Hedge and Shrub Maintenance with Cordless Hedge Trimmers

Lawns aren’t the only living elements of a good outdoor space. In many cases, you’ll have bushes and shrubs. When these are kept under control, they might elevate the space. When they run out of control, they can do the opposite.

The best way to stay on top of your hedges and bushes is usually to invest in a quality cordless hedge trimmer. This will make it much more convenient, and fast, to maintain the space – which means that the cost of keeping it beautiful will be lowered.

Sustainable Irrigation Systems for Commercial Landscapes

The right irrigation system can have a big effect on the cost of maintenance, as well as your company’s ability to meet the requirements set out by environmental law. In many cases, greywater and blackwater systems can be hugely useful. Waste water from other areas of the business can be automatically channelled toward a garden, and used to water non-edible plants.

Innovative Hardscaping Materials and Installation Solutions

There are landscaping elements that don’t involve any plant matter at all. These elements tend to be easier to maintain, since they won’t die – or grow.

Paths, patios and retaining walls are increasingly being constructed using sustainable materials, like bamboo. Permeable paving, which reduces run-off and drives up groundwater recharge, is desirable – as is reclaimed stone, which can be used in walls and other structures.

Landscape Lighting and Automation for Enhanced Aesthetics and Security

Smart outdoor lighting solutions can help to make an outdoor space look the part. Better yet, it can help to deter thieves and other intruders. By integrating the outdoor lighting system into that of the business as a whole, and by generating power on-site through the use of solar panels, you’ll be able to create a garden space that’s eco-friendly and easy to manage – even in locations where access to the grid is difficult to come by.
